Production statistics

  • Year 1914
    Period 1906 - 1914
    Material ORE
    Accuracy Estimate
    Description Cp_Grade: ^4 % Cu, 15 Oz/Ton Ag, $4.00 In Au Per Ton.
    Importance Item Commodity Group Amount recovered Grade Recovery percentage
    Minor Ore Silver Silver 424g/mt
    Major Ore Copper Copper 4wt-pct

Comments on the production information

  • MADE SHIPMENT OF HIGH - GRADE SILVER ORE IN 1937 AND 1938 , RAN OVER 100 OUNCES AG PER TON.

Comments on the workings information

  • 5 CLAIMS; WORKINGS; SEVERAL TUNNELS, TWO ARE 800 AND 200 FT. LONG. ABOVE 200 FT. TUNNEL, STOPE 20 FT. LONG AND 50 FT. HIGH TO SURFACE.

General comments

Subject category Comment text
Deposit ORE OCCURS IN NARROW, BARITE VEIN IN THIN BELT OF SCHIST ON CONTACT OF MONZONITE AND GRANITE.
